Oxygen Corrosion Problem
Dissolved oxygen in water causes severe pitting corrosion in steel piping, boilers, and equipment. Even trace oxygen at parts-per-billion levels damages metal surfaces. Chemical scavengers react with oxygen forming harmless compounds preventing corrosive attack.

Chemical Types
Sodium sulfite most common reacting with oxygen forming sulfate. Hydrazine for high-pressure boilers though toxicity concerns limit use. Organic scavengers like carbohydrazide safer alternatives. Catalyzed formulations speed reaction. Selection depends on system pressure, temperature, and water chemistry.
Injection Points
Boiler feedwater deaerator outlet removing residual oxygen after mechanical deaeration. Closed cooling systems at circulation pump suction. Process water before critical equipment. Location ensures adequate mixing and reaction time.
Dosing Control
Residual oxygen analyzer provides feedback for automatic control. Fixed ratio dosing based on water flow common in simple systems. Proportional control adjusts chemical feed maintaining target residual. Control strategy balances protection versus chemical cost.
Operating Pressure
Pump discharge pressure 50-300 psig overcomes injection point pressure plus piping losses. Positive displacement metering pumps provide accurate dosing across pressure variations. Pulsation dampeners protect downstream instrumentation.
Material Selection
Chemical-resistant construction throughout. Polyethylene or stainless steel tanks. Pump wetted parts compatible with scavenger chemistry. Injection tubing and fittings resist chemical attack. Design prevents corrosion from treatment chemical itself.

Monitoring Systems
Oxygen analyzers verify treatment effectiveness. Low oxygen indicates proper scavenging. High oxygen signals dosing issues. Chemical feed verification confirms pump operation. Integration with plant controls enables remote monitoring.
